Hello. I am Scott DeWitt. My wife, Jonna, and I have been serving in full-time ministry for all of our adult lives. We have had a calling to serve God and His people since we were young. Our relationship with Casas por Cristo started in 1999 when I was serving as a youth minister in Illinois. We discovered a love for missions after leading several youth trips with Casas. I then served a short time on the Board of Trustees at Casas. In 2006, God took our love and passion for missions and my position on the Board of Trustees and turned them into a full-time ministry at Casas. I was given the opportunity to move from a ministry serving youth to a ministry serving the poor in México. For the first seven and a half years on staff, I served as the Director of Spiritual Outreach. At the beginning of 2014, I transitioned to serving as the Acuña Field Director, and after five years, I am now the Vice President of México Operations, overseeing both our Acuña and Juárez locations. There is nothing my family would rather do than to serve God through this ministry. We feel blessed to be part of what God is doing through Casas and all who partner with us.
